Things You Need to Know When Selecting a Packaging Material

3 Mins read

If you’re looking for a new way to present your products, you’ve probably come across several different types of packaging materials. But what should you be aware of? Here are some things you need to consider when selecting a material. First, it should fit your product’s style. Choose a material that showcases your products in the best possible light. Second, make sure your packaging is easy to open and remove. Third, consider the material’s durability. Stress testing can help you test the material’s durability. For example, if you’re unsure of whether the material will hold up under shipping, you can simulate bends, pressure, and even a package being thrown.

Third, think about the supply chain. Packaging materials must be able to withstand the entire supply chain.
